Step-by-Step Preparation

Preparing the Dough

Start by activating your yeast in warm water with a bit of sugar. Once bubbly, mix it with melted butter, milk, and eggs. Gradually add flour until a soft dough forms. Knead the dough until smooth and let it rise until doubled in size.

Making the Filling

For the filling, blend together cream cheese, sugar, lemon zest, and a touch of vanilla extract until smooth. Spread this mixture over the rolled-out dough, then evenly distribute fresh blueberries over the top.

Assembling the Rolls

Roll the dough tightly into a log and slice it into even pieces. Arrange the slices in a greased baking dish, ensuring they have enough space to rise during baking. Cover them with a cloth and let them rise again until doubled.

Baking to Perfection

Preheat your oven to 350°F and bake the rolls until golden brown. While baking, prepare a lemon glaze by mixing powdered sugar, lemon juice, and a splash of milk. Drizzle the glaze over the warm rolls before serving.

Lemon Blueberry Sweet Rolls Dessert

Avatar photoMarla Jennings
These Lemon Blueberry Sweet Rolls are a delicious and vibrant treat perfect for spring. With a tangy lemon glaze and sweet blueberry filling, they are ideal for brunches and special occasions.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 50 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 10 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 8 slices
Calories 320 kcal

Equipment

  • 1 9-inch round cake pan greased and floured
  • 1 Electric Mixer
  • 1 Mixing Bowl large

Ingredients
  

Dough

  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1 tbsp instant yeast
  • 1/2 cup milk warm
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ter melted
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 tsp salt

Filling

  • 1 cup fresh blueberries
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 2 tbsp lemon zest
  • 1/4 cup cream cheese softened

Lemon Glaze

  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 2 tbsp lemon juice
  • 1 tbsp milk

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 9-inch round cake pan.
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ine warm milk, yeast, and sugar. Let it sit until bubbly, about 5 minutes. Add melted butter, eggs, and salt. Mix in the flour gradually until a dough forms.
  • Knead the dough on a floured surface for about 10 minutes until smooth and elastic. Place it in a greased bowl, cover, and let rise until doubled, about 1 hour.

Filling

  • In a bowl, mix cream cheese, sugar, and lemon zest until smooth. Roll out the dough into a rectangle and spread the filling evenly over it. Sprinkle blueberries on top.

Assembly

  • Roll the dough tightly from one long side to the other. Slice into 8 equal pieces and place them in the prepared pan. Cover and let rise again for 30 minutes.

Baking

  • Bake the rolls in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until golden brown on top. Let them cool slightly in the pan before glazing.

Serving

  • Mix powdered sugar, lemon juice, and milk to make the glaze. Drizzle over the warm rolls before serving.

Storage

  • Store any leftover rolls in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days, or refrigerate for up to a week for freshness.

FAQ

Can I use frozen blueberries in this recipe?

Yes, you can use frozen blueberries if fresh ones are not available. Simply thaw the frozen blueberries slightly and drain any excess liquid before incorporating them into the filling. This helps prevent the rolls from becoming too soggy during baking. Keep in mind that frozen blueberries may slightly alter the texture, but the flavor will still be delicious.

How can I make these sweet rolls dairy-free?

To make these sweet rolls dairy-free, substitute plant-based alternatives for the butter and cream cheese. Use a dairy-free butter spread and a vegan cream cheese for the filling. Additionally, ensure your milk of choice for the dough is a non-dairy variety, such as almond milk or oat milk, to maintain the recipe’s integrity while accommodating dietary needs.
